Testimonial

A single slide in the Testimonials section: a quote on a green panel, a lifestyle photo, and a bar naming the product the reviewer is talking about with a link to buy it.

Setting What it does
Quote The testimonial text.
Reviewer name Shown under the quote.
Attribution Shown after the name, separated by a dot — e.g. “Verified Purchase”.
Star rating How many filled stars appear above the quote. 0–5; set to 0 to hide them.
Image The lifestyle photo beside the quote.
Setting What it does
Product The product being reviewed. Its name, image, link and star rating all come from here.
Product name override Replaces the product’s title on this card only.
Product image override Replaces the product’s featured image.
Button label Defaults to “Shop” followed by the product name.
Button link Defaults to the product page.

Pick a product and the bar fills itself in — you only need the override fields when merchandising should differ from the product record.

The star rating and review count (“4.8 (1,350 Reviews)”) are read from the product’s Stamped review data. They aren’t editable here.

  • The two star ratings are different things. The stars above the quote are this reviewer’s rating, set by hand. The stars in the product bar are the product’s overall average from Stamped.
  • Write the attribution the same way every time. “Verified Purchase” across all slides reads as a credibility signal; mixed wording reads as noise.
  • Leave the button label empty unless you need something specific — the default keeps it consistent with the product name.
